Output efa2fc6c286c8389266c74c8f76227ca883ea2c8bbfdfaa28d1bb353ce1cb28b:0

value
984643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db966071725e745845e4fc9382227e6e162a3cd8 OP_EQUAL
address
3Mi63uunyDN4p1gDqtnhrh5opAxZ1Xdx7A
transaction
efa2fc6c286c8389266c74c8f76227ca883ea2c8bbfdfaa28d1bb353ce1cb28b
confirmations
383592
spent
true